<br />(l;16~l <br /> <br />October 2, 1992 <br /> <br />Appendix B <br /> <br />Plan of Study /Task Description <br /> <br />Introduction: Provide appropriate introductory comments and information; discuss purpose <br />and background; describe study process. <br /> <br />Phase I <br /> <br />Task 1 - <br />(5%) <br /> <br />Summary of general issues in Rural-Urban Water Transfers <br /> <br />a) Describe and summarize general issues relating to rural to urban and <br />agricultural to non-agricultural water transfers. <br /> <br />b) Describe factors that contribute to, or make possible, water transfers <br />from the Arkansas River Valley including social, economic, agricultural, <br />and demographic factors. <br /> <br />c) <br /> <br />Describe and summarize historic water transfers in Arkansas River <br />Valley (Pueblo to Colorado-Kansas state line), and their social, <br />economic, agricultural, and environmental impacts in the valley. <br /> <br />( <br /> <br />Task 2 - Evaluate demand for Ft. Lyon Canal Co. water <br />(10%) <br />General demand patterns shall be established for the Front Range metropolitan <br />areas and other locations deemed likely to seek Arkansas River supplies. Analysis <br />shall include the magnitude and timing of the demand and whether the demand is <br />for: <br /> <br />a) - base supply <br />b) - interruptable supply <br />c) - drought period supply <br />d) - steady or variable demand <br />e) - other, as appropriate <br /> <br />Task 3A - Description of Ft.
